1. Energy Efficiency
One of the biggest benefits of Anderson windows is their energy efficiency. These windows are designed with sustainability in mind and are made with high-quality materials that are meant to reduce your home's energy consumption. Anderson windows are equipped with Low-E glass, which is a type of glass that has a special coating that reflects heat, keeping the inside of your home cooler during hot summer months and warmer during cold winter months. This feature helps to reduce your energy bills and save you money in the long run.

2. Durability
Another positive benefit of Anderson windows is their durability. These windows are made with high-quality materials such as vinyl, wood, and fiberglass, which are known for their strength and resilience. They are built to withstand harsh weather conditions and are less likely to scratch, dent or warp. This means that you won't have to worry about constantly replacing your windows, saving you both time and money.

3. Low Maintenance
Anderson windows are also known for their low maintenance. Unlike traditional wood windows that require frequent painting and staining, Anderson windows are made with vinyl and other materials that do not need to be repainted or stained. Simply cleaning them with a damp cloth and a mild detergent will keep them looking new and shining for years to come. This low maintenance feature is a popular choice for busy homeowners who do not have the time to constantly maintain their windows.
